“COLTRANE: A LOVE SUPREME,” VIRTUAL LIVE CONCERT FEATURING THE JAZZ AT LINCOLN CENTER ORCHESTRA WITH WYNTON MARSALIS PREMIERES ON JUNE 10, 2021

“COLTRANE: A LOVE SUPREME,” VIRTUAL LIVE CONCERT FEATURING THE JAZZ AT LINCOLN CENTER ORCHESTRA WITH WYNTON MARSALIS PREMIERES ON JUNE 10, 2021

Special Guest Camille Thurman and big band perform Coltrane works predicated upon concepts of freedom and liberation, both temporal and spiritual

Beginning on June 10, at 7:30pm ET, in the final Jazz at Lincoln Center Orchestra with Wynton Marsalis concert of Jazz at Lincoln Center’s virtual spring season, the world renowned orchestra will perform a big band rendition of John Coltrane’s immortal A Love Supreme. In this concert event entitled, “Coltrane: A Love Supreme,” saxophonist Camille Thurman will be featured as guest soloist with the Jazz at Lincoln Center Orchestra to perform the seminal piece as well as arrangements of Coltrane works predicated upon concepts of freedom and liberation, both temporal and spiritual.

Announcing “Blues Symphony (Symphony No. 2), Recording of Wynton Marsalis’s Second Symphony Performed by The Philadelphia Orchestra Conducted by Cristian Macelaru

ANNOUNCING BLUES SYMPHONY (Symphony No. 2), RECORDING OF WYNTON MARSALIS’S SECOND SYMPHONY PERFORMED BY THE PHILADELPHIA ORCHESTRA CONDUCTED BY CRISTIAN MĂCELARU

A celebration of the blues refracted through the prism of American history and folklore; available exclusively on digital platforms

Today, Blue Engine Records releases the first recording of Blues Symphony (Symphony No. 2), an innovative and colossal work from Pulitzer Prize-winning composer Wynton Marsalis. In the hands of The Philadelphia Orchestra under the direction of celebrated conductor Cristian Măcelaru, Blues Symphony (Marsalis’s second symphony) takes the 12-bar blues and explodes it into a lyrical, kaleidoscopic history of American music.
